    Smart Car made of Sand!
    Saw this whilst on Hols last year in Jersey.
    It took 3 days to make and the guy who made it, camped on the beach next to it so that no smarmy kids would kick it down
    The sand sticks together because they mix PVA glue with it.
    And it is to scale!
